Riyadh - Saba
The official spokesman for the coalition forces, the "Coalition to Support Legitimacy in Yemen," Brigadier General Turki Al-Maliki, announced the completion of the exchange of prisoners and detainees by releasing (104) Houthi prisoners held by the coalition, on a humanitarian initiative from the Kingdom.
Brigadier General Al-Maliki said, in a statement published by the Saudi Press Agency (SPA), that "this initiative comes as an extension of previous humanitarian initiatives from the Kingdom related to prisoners, and to support efforts aimed at stabilizing the armistice and creating an atmosphere of dialogue between the Yemeni parties to reach a comprehensive and sustainable political solution that ends the Yemeni crisis."
